I was wondering, if anyone is a starcity casino gold member? If there is any benefit and etc? :)
 
Re: Starcity Casino Gold Membership Benefit

It would appear your main benefits (over the other tiers) would be:

  • Unlimited non-alcoholic drinks
  • Free parking
  • 20% off dining

I was in the Platinum Suite at StarCity only a few weeks ago. Quite a nice reward for those who are "loyal" to them... Great (free) drinks, a heavily subsidised restaurant (with great meals) and great views over Sydney.

The Gold Suite is also ok in Starcity, although Platinum is much nicer.

Now the room people really want to access is the room reserved for the top 30 players of the casino ... It has a beautiful staircase leading up there, and the perks of that type of membership are amazing.

Of course, you need to spend a LOT to get access to any of those rooms - unless you're the guest of someone who does... (I was in the latter category).

The comps are good too if you turnover a lot of money. Limo transfers, loan of Ferraris, reimbursement of airfare, jet transfers, accommodation and a host of other benefits that are known to those who qualify.

I know that at *city, hotel benefits are (frequently un-promoted) often as high as 60 - 70% discount's, a friend is Gold at Star and frequently takes advantage. You also receive frequent unpublished member offers. There is one high roller level above Gold at *city I am aware of, unsure of its name, but guarantees high rollers access - my ex boss had that...

I have Crown Gold, this is due to excessive consumption of all that Crown has to offer including gambling, restaurants and shopping, all of which I collect status credits that lead to higher Crown status.

I get frequent offers of heavily discounted hotel rooms, guaranteed to be when I don't want a hotel in town, restaurant and show offers, I get free drinks at all private areas except the mahogany room which I do not have access to. There are two levels above Gold at Crown I can obtain, they are Platinum and Black.

Oz_mark is 100% correct in saying that you have to spend $,$$$,$$$.$$ to be invited to the high levels although with Crown, not necessarily on gambling - a buying spree at Versace or Prada could net you higher status in one credit card transaction!
